Happy Family's shares referred to the shares of Happy Family Food Group Co., Ltd. Happy Family Food Group Co., Ltd. was a large-scale private comprehensive food production enterprise specializing in the production and operation of coconut juice plant protein drinks, fruit juice drinks, yogurt drinks and canned fruits. The company was founded in 2001. After nearly 20 years of development, it formed a product line centered on canned oranges and yellow peaches. Happy Family coconut juice and Happy Family canned fruit were very popular among consumers. The company currently has a number of subsidiary companies that have passed the certification of the international quality management system, which guarantees the high standards and quality of the products. The breeding method of the royal shared little princess was as follows: First, it was necessary to use soil with good drainage, which could be mixed with peaty soil and pearlites. The soil's ph should be between 6.0 and 7.5. Secondly, the royal shared little princess was fleshy and liked plenty of light, so she needed to be placed in an environment with plenty of light. In addition, the temperature was also key. They adapted to warm environments, and the most suitable temperature range was 15 degrees Celsius to 30 degrees Celsius. When breeding indoors, they could be placed in a window or balcony with plenty of sunlight, but they had to avoid exposure to the sun, especially at noon in summer. In general, the royal family shared the little princess's succulent breeding needs to pay attention to soil drainage, light, and temperature.
